Gold rises Rs11,700/tola in Pakistan

Gold prices moved higher in Pakistan on Saturday, tracking an upward trend in the global market.
In the domestic market, the price of gold per tola climbed to Rs519,462, showing an increase of Rs11,700 during the day. At the same time, the rate for 10 grams of gold rose by Rs10,030 and was sold at Rs445,354, figures released by the All-Pakistan Gems and Jewellers Sarafa Association (APGJSA) showed.
A day earlier, on Friday, gold prices had fallen sharply, with the per tola rate dropping by Rs21,400 to settle at Rs507,762.
On the international front, gold prices also strengthened, gaining $117 to reach $4,967 per ounce, including a $20 premium.
Silver prices followed the same trend, rising by Rs444 to stand at Rs8,269 per tola in the local market.
